Brighthouse Financial is one of the largest U.S. annuity and life insurance providers with $206B in AUM and over 2 million policies in force. Revenue comes from fees on variable annuities, Shield Annuities, and life products; substantially all revenues originate in the U.S. A pending acquisition by Aquarian Parent is expected to close in 2026.
